Print-on-Demand Revolution Drives the Global Direct-to-Garment Pigment Ink Market Toward USD 720 Million by 2034
Direct to Garment Pigment Ink market was valued at USD 561 million in 2025 and is projected to reach USD 720 million by 2034, exhibiting a remarkable CAGR of 3.7% during the forecast period.
Direct to Garment (DTG) pigment inks are water based formulations specifically engineered for inkjet style printing directly onto textiles such as cotton, polyester cotton blends and lightweight synthetics. They comprise finely milled pigment particles, polymeric binders, humectants, surfactants and proprietary additives that together satisfy the viscosity and surface tension requirements of piezoelectric or thermal printheads. The pigment dispersion delivers exceptional colour intensity, sharp edge definition and, after curing, a wash fastness rating that typically exceeds 4 5 years of repeated laundering. Because the inks are solvent free, they generate markedly lower volatile organic compound (VOC) emissions compared with traditional solvent based screen inks, aligning with growing environmental regulatory expectations in North America and Europe.
